How they compare

Sierra Leone currently reports 8,497 US dollar per square kilometre against 7,289 US dollar per square kilometre in Bolivia, Plurinational State of, a difference of 1,208 US dollar per square kilometre.

That makes Sierra Leone's figure about 1.2 times Bolivia, Plurinational State of's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Bolivia, Plurinational State of ahead.

Bolivia, Plurinational State of ranks 148th and Sierra Leone ranks 146th of 169 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Bolivia, Plurinational State of averaged higher in 1 and Sierra Leone in 2.
